Kazakh Industry and Infrastructure Development Ministry implements 32 PPP projects
According to the Minister, the “Construction and exploitation of the road “Big Almaty Ring Road (BAKAD)” project is under way, with its first driveway slated for opening in 2021 and the expected traffic flow of 38 000 cars a day.
The “Nurly zholy” crossing point on the section of the “Almaty-Khorgos” road (Western Europe-Western China) was put into use on June 22, 2018. The Minister stated that the concessionaire’s contractual commitments are fulfilled in a full manner. Vehicle checks’ time fell by 4 times, and the daily freight traffic is 200 cars.
The “Open toll system” project leading to the roll-out of charging on 11 thousand kilometers of roads of republican significance is also under realisation.
The project “Construction of the Shar-Ust-Kamenogorsk railway line” stretching 153 kilometers has already been completed. The concession period lasts until 2028 with subsequent handing over the line to Kazakh Temir Zholy National Company. To date, cargo movements through the Shar-Ust-Kamenogorsk line estimate over 9 million tons of goods a year.
Between 2020 and 2022, there are plans to carry out construction works on the “Construction of a 73.2km railway line bypassing the Almaty station”.
Potential investors are sought to implement the airport project in the city of Turkestan.
This March a start has been given to a paperless environment system in air freight of all the airports called e-Freight, which involved the Kazakh airlines. Elaborations are made to integrate with the finance and agriculture ministries’ information systems.
21 projects in the housing and communal services sector are at the implementation and development stage.
Projects in the energy conservation field are under way in Pavlodar, Atyrau, Almaty, Kyzylorda regions, as well as in the city of Almaty. Meanwhile, Almaty, Akmola regions and Eastern Kazakhstan carry out projects in the heating field.
1 project on water is under way in Mangistau region.
“Given the Prime Minister’s task, the Ministry works out a package of legislative, financial and other necessary measures to ensure the sector is an investment destination”, Roman Sklyar said.
The housing and communal services sector represents a huge potential for scaled-up PPP. The Government’s share makes up 90% of the water supply, heating and wastewater disposal systems.
